Arnold "Arnie"

Hurwit

Obituary

Arnold “Arnie” Hurwit, 83, of West Hartford, passed away at home on Wednesday, January 26th, after a long illness. He is survived by his devoted wife of 63 years, Sondra “Sandy” Katz Hurwit, his three daughters, Janis Sullivan and her husband Michael of Mesquite, NV, Laurie Strauss and her husband Steve of West Hartford, Cindy Langer and her husband Al of Cromwell, grandchildren Michael Trenholm, Jennifer Strauss, and Adam Strauss, and great-grandchildren Jessica and Cierra Trenholm, and Dyllan, Logan and Amaya Trafford. He was born in Hartford to the late James S. and Mary Gitlin Hurwit and was predeceased by his brother Carl G. Hurwit. Arnie attended West Hartford Public Schools, graduated from Hall High School in 1945, and also attended University of Connecticut, before marrying the love of his life, Sandy, in 1947. In his early career, he managed and operated Hurwit Hardware on Park St. in Hartford. In the late 1950s, he entered the field of real estate and later became a real estate developer, which was his passion. After his retirement, he and Sandy spent their winters in Sarasota, FL, for several years. He was a member of Congregation Beth Israel of West Hartford and The West Hartford Regents. Arnie enjoyed spending time with his family, playing golf, tennis and bridge, and his favorite hobby of “medicine.” He was affectionately known to many as “Dr. Hurwit” and had a wonderful talent for medical intuition. He was a wise, gentle, patient and loving husband, father and friend. He will be remembered for so many special things, especially his wonderful sense of humor. He will be greatly missed by all who knew him.
